Signal President on Data Privacy, Free Expression, and AI's Social Impact

FRANCE 24 EnglishJune 7, 202510 min7,365 views
17 connections·19 entities in this video

The Importance of Data Privacy

  • 💡 Data about your location, communications, and contacts can be used to harm, control, or limit your access to resources and opportunities.
  • 🎯 A few tech companies collect vast amounts of personal data, often using it in ways that are not beneficial to users.
  • 🔒 Signal exists to provide meaningful privacy by not collecting user data, enabling truly private online communication.

Privacy as a Structural Issue

  • 💬 While individuals may care about privacy, the problem is structural, not just a personal choice, as participation in society often requires using data-collecting technologies.
  • 🗣️ The freedom to express oneself, challenge ideas, and dissent is fundamentally reliant on privacy and the ability to communicate privately.
  • ⚠️ The argument "nothing to hide, nothing to fear" is flawed because what is considered wrong can change, and data collected can be used against individuals later, as seen in a case where Facebook DMs were used in a reproductive healthcare legal case.

Data Collection and Its Uses

  • 🌐 Internet and AI companies collect massive amounts of data, which can be used for distributing resources or for monitoring and surveillance.
  • 🧠 Engagement-driven algorithms can warp users' sense of reality, prioritizing short-term company benefits over societal well-being.
  • ⚖️ The critical questions are who decides what data is collected and for whose benefit it is used.

AI and Social Implications

  • 🤖 Technologies like AI are increasingly embedded in decision-making processes for healthcare, education, and information consumption, making their social implications significant.
  • 🔍 There's a need for more research and discussion on the role of AI in society and who controls its development and deployment.
  • 🏢 Large tech companies with significant infrastructure and data hold immense power and responsibility in shaping how governments and institutions operate, necessitating democratic oversight.

Technology and Governance

  • 🚀 Signal demonstrates that technology can be developed differently—in an open, rights-preserving, and private way—even within an industry often focused on mass data collection.
  • 🌍 The future is less about technology itself and more about governance and defining the type of world we want to build, with technology serving that vision.
